ADark Souls 3player is attempting to beat the game’s bosses using bananas as controllers. This is not the first time that fans of the famously difficult game have attempted to play it using unorthodox methods as the same player managed tobeat the game using Donkey Kong bongosonly.

The bizarre method of play was pulled off by Twitch streamer TheSuperScrubs and documented on Twitter. The fruity controller schemes uses the Makey Makey system and 10 bananas in total, with each one standing in for a mouse or keyboard input (including the WASD keyboard keys, the left and right mouse clicks and the rolling wheel). Excluding the price of a bunch of bananas (or two) the parts required for the inputs are only said to have totalled a few dollars altogether.

Somewhat surprisingly, TheSuperScrubs’Dark Souls 3banana run only led to 16 deaths overall, if the Twitter video is to be believed.
